Hughton has had very little chance to build his own side. In his first transfer window, it was about shipping players out, and in the second, his scope was limited but he definitely improved the side. Generally speaking, he's had to make do and mend with the leftovers from other managers' work.

 

There's a lack of pace about the side which I'm sure he'll try and address. Once he's had the chance to create his own team, then we can assess him.

 

But as for how he's coped with the task that fell in his lap, he can't be faulted.
